Arturo boards a Ferris wheel at the 3-o'clock position and rides the Ferris wheel for multiple revolutions. The Ferris wheel rotates at a constant angular speed. Let h represent Arturo's height above the center of the Ferris wheel (in feet) and let t represent the number of mintues since the ride started. a. Suppose the radius of the Ferris wheel is 15 feet and the Ferris wheel rotates at 1 radian per minute.
